When Should Software Companies Consider Automation Testing

by Nasir Hanif

The software test automation market, which was valued at approximately USD 25.43 billion in 2022, has been growing rapidly and was projected to achieve a compounded annual growth rate (CAGR) of over 17% between 2023 and 2030. Most of this growth is attributed to the crucial role that software testing plays in ensuring the quality and reliability of software products.

But Why Automate Software Testing?

While manual testing is instrumental in finding critical errors in newly developed apps, automated testing promises to save more time and can be highly accurate. That’s why QA engineers prefer to switch to automation for repeated tests or after they are done with the very first phase of testing a new product.

Whether you are developing a new application or want to improve your existing products, you can optimize delivery cycles with automated testing services from a top-rated provider like KMS. Teaming up with such a provider is an effortless and more economical way of leveraging automated testing since you won’t have to worry about acquiring systems or hiring an in-house team of experts.

When Does Software Testing Automation Make Sense?

According to experts, here are the best times to automate your testing:

1. When the Cost Makes Sense

If you can save costs without messing up the quality of a product, then – by all means – do it. Software automation is a perfect solution for companies that want to test with speed and accuracy without putting too much pressure on their bank account.

Though automation is quite expensive and makes more sense for larger, more complex projects, you still can reduce the costs by using testing automation services. That way, you are only paying for the testing services you need, when you need them.

2. If You Have Repetitive Tests

Some situations require you to run the same test repeatedly without changing it. It would make more sense to leverage automation, thanks to the time efficiency and ease of execution.

Besides, automated testing will give you more in-depth and reliable results, unlike manual testing which is prone to inconsistency.

3. You Want to Run Tests Frequently

Software testing automation gives you the capacity to run tests at a more frequent rate, which is almost impossible in manual testing. Manual testing gives you limited capabilities, especially when you are a smaller company without a dedicated in-house QA & testing team.

Luckily, you can use automated software testing services to run tests as often as required without acquiring test automation systems.

4. When You Need to Run Many Tests at Once

It can be difficult and almost impossible to run multiple manual tests at once, and that’s where automation comes in. With this type of testing, your teams can test rapidly without feeling the pressure.

And unlike manual testing which won’t allow you to run the same test on different machines at the same time, automated testing makes it possible to do so with ease, while being more accurate.

5. When Dealing with High-Risk Cases

Some tests carry a higher risk value than others, requiring the greatest detail to attention for reliable results. Automated testing would be your best bet in such cases since the systems you are using aren’t subject to human factors such as fatigue and others that can reduce accuracy.

6. During Cross-Platform Testing

Cross-platform testing requires the execution of the same test in different ways, and that can be a lot of work if done manually. The better way to do it would be to run such tests automatically so that you only tweak the systems to fit the platform that you are testing for.

That gives you the confidence that your application will work perfectly on both platforms.

Test Better With KMS

Whether you are building a new application or want to enhance an existing one, automated software testing will go a long way. Not only does it help you to run tests more intensively and extensively, but it’ll also save you a lot of time that you can use to improve your products even further.

The best part is that with top-notch software testing automation services from a highly-rated provider like KMS, you won’t even have to worry about the cost of acquiring and running automation tools.

